The dataset was created at the Lab for Measurement Technology (Saarland University). It consists the raw signals (proportional to the logarithmic conductance) of two temperature-modulated semiconductor metaloxide gas sensors (ScioSense AS-MLV and AS-MLV-P2, former AppliedSensor, ams). An exact description of the measurement setup and its results can be found in the open access article: Baur, T., Bastuck, M., Schultealbert, C., Sauerwald, T., and Schütze, A.: Random gas mixtures for efficient gas sensor calibration, J. Sens. Sens. Syst., 9, 411–424, 2020, https://doi.org/10.5194/jsss-9-411-2020 <strong>Dataset:</strong><br> The mat-file comprises diffrent datasets: <strong>as_mlv: </strong>raw signal (~ logarithmic conductance) of the AS-MLV containing 12202 sensor cycles with 12000 data points (@ 100 Hz) <strong>as_mlv_p2: </strong>raw signal (~ logarithmic conductance) of the AS-MLV-P2 containing 12202 sensor cycles with 12000 data points (@ 100 Hz) <strong>as_mlv_targets and as_mlv_p2_targets:</strong> <strong>acetone: </strong>acetone concentration in ppb <strong>benzene</strong>: benzene concentration in ppb <strong>formaldehyde</strong>: formaldehyde concentration in ppb, NaN values are undefined formaldehyde concentrations <strong>toluene</strong>: toluene concentration in ppb <strong>carbon_monoxide</strong>: carbon monoxide concentration in ppb <strong>hydrogen</strong>: hydrogen concentration in ppb <strong>humidity</strong>: relative humidity in %RH <strong>voc_sum_ppb: </strong>sum of all VOC concentations (acetone, toluene, formaldehyde, benzene) in ppb <strong>voc_sum_ugm3: </strong>sum of all VOC concentations (acetone, toluene, formaldehyde, benzene) in µg/m<sup>3</sup> <strong>count</strong>: number of the gas mixture exposure, each gas mixture exposure contains approx.10 sensor cycles <strong>measurement</strong>: number of the measurement, each measurement contains approx.100 gas exposures <strong>ranges</strong>: marked cycles for the data evaluation with group number
